THE ENTIRE NIGERIA IS INSECURE– Peter Obi

THE ENTIRE NIGERIA IS INSECURE-

By Olusegun HOSEA.

The Presidential flag bearer of the Labour Party, Peter Obi has said that the entire Nigeria is insecure. He disclosed this at the Party’s Presidential rally held in Akure, in Ondo State on Saturday 14th, January, 2023.

According to him, the entire Nigeria is insecured as people are living in fear while killing is every where. He berated the ruling party , APC and the PDP for looting the Nation treasury and causing poverty in the land . He said the two political parties candidates are corrupt and as a result of this ,he asked the Nigerians not to vote for them in the forth coming general election.

Speaking further, he said if he become President, he would make sure that the security Agencies works in a good environment. He promised to provide them a good  insurance policy against any unforeseen circumstances (death) that may likely happened to them in the cause of carrying out their duties to the nation.
He continued his words on the security that he and his running mate Senator Datti would want to secured Nigeria and moving the country forward from the level of consumption to construction.

He said he would support business to growth and made the environment conducive for the business to thrive.
In another development, Obi said it’s time for all to see ourselves as one Nigerians rather than dwelling on the ethnicity and segregation which had posing a barrier for us to move forward as a country.

In his words ” we don’t want Tribe and Religion again. It’s your turn to take back your Country. We want to change Nigeria, go and pick up your PVC , vote Labour Party and stand by your Votes”.
Similarly, he spoke on the educational system in the country , that Nigerians Youths and the lecturers would not have any cuase to go on strike if he become the President of the Federal Republic of Nigeria, as their four years duration course would be four years.He promised to end strike in the Universities if elected.

He also said that if given the mandate he would make sure that every Nigerians live a better life and he would make life better for them so that they could be proud that they are Nigerians.

Obi who said he and his running mate Ahmed Datti are the most qualified Nigerians to rule this country as they both have good records to be proud of.

He however, promised to give electricity to the southern part of the Ondo State if he become President.
In the words of his running mate, Senator Datti, he said Nothern Nigerians are ready for the Labour Party. He also said he is proud to be a Nigerian and associated with the Yoruba people.

He said we need to respect all Nigerians. He opinioned that anybody that doesn’t respect you will not lead you well. He accused APC and PDP of looting the Nation’s treasury .He however, said that they would stop the killing and start the healing of Nigeria.

In the words of Chief Sola Ebiseni, the Labour Party South West Coordinator, said he was sent by the Afenifere (The Yoruba Socio Cultural Ethnic group) to tell the people of Ondo State that it’s the turn of Obi to be the President.

He said they picked Obi based on his credibility as he was not owning any body while he was a Governor. Ebiseni, who is the General Secretary of the Afenifere, said that Yoruba and Housa people has done it before , and now it’s the turn of the South East to produce the next President.

He concluded by saying that we are people of honour in Yoruba land and as a result of that , he asked people to vote for their candidates.
